一般用什么软件写编程

fiy 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程人员在日常工作中通常使用各种软件来编写代码。以下是一些常用的编程软件:

    1. 集成开发环境(IDE):IDE是一种集成了多个开发工具的软件,方便开发人员进行代码编写、调试和测试。常见的IDE有Eclipse、Visual Studio、IntelliJ IDEA等。这些IDE提供了丰富的功能,如代码自动完成、调试器、版本控制等,能够大大提高开发效率。

    2. 文本编辑器:文本编辑器是一种轻量级的软件,用于编辑纯文本文件,常用于编写代码。一些常见的文本编辑器有Sublime Text、Notepad++、Atom等。这些编辑器具有代码高亮、语法检查等功能,适合编写各种编程语言的代码。

    3. 命令行编辑器:命令行编辑器是一种在终端或命令行界面下进行编辑的软件,常用于编写脚本和命令行程序。常见的命令行编辑器有Vim、Emacs等。这些编辑器功能强大,但学习曲线较陡峭。

    4. 特定领域软件:某些领域的编程需要使用特定的软件。例如,Web开发人员通常会使用Web开发框架(如React、Angular、Vue.js)和编辑器(如WebStorm、Visual Studio Code)来编写前端代码;数据科学家使用Jupyter Notebook等软件来编写和运行数据分析代码。

    总的来说,选择哪种编程软件取决于个人的喜好和需求。不同的软件具有不同的优势和功能,可以根据具体情况选择最合适的工具。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程领域,有许多不同的软件可以用来编写代码。以下是一些常用的编程软件:

    1.文本编辑器:文本编辑器是编写代码的最基本工具。它们通常具有简单的界面和基本的编辑功能,如代码高亮显示和自动缩进。一些常见的文本编辑器包括Notepad++、Sublime Text和Atom。这些文本编辑器适用于多种编程语言,并提供许多插件和扩展功能。

    2.集成开发环境(IDE):IDE是一种集成了各种开发工具和功能的软件。它们通常包括代码编辑器、调试器、编译器和构建工具等功能。IDE可以提供更强大的开发环境,帮助开发人员更高效地编写和调试代码。一些常见的IDE包括Visual Studio、Eclipse和IntelliJ IDEA。每个IDE都针对特定的编程语言或开发平台进行了优化。

    3.命令行编辑器:命令行编辑器是在命令行界面下编写代码的工具。它们通常具有强大的自动补全和代码片段功能,可以提高开发效率。一些常见的命令行编辑器包括Vim和Emacs。这些编辑器具有高度可定制性和扩展性,使用户可以根据自己的需求进行配置。

    4.可视化编程工具:可视化编程工具允许开发人员使用图形界面而不是编写代码来创建应用程序。这些工具通常提供拖放式的界面设计和代码生成功能,适用于初学者或非编程背景的人。一些常见的可视化编程工具包括Scratch和Blockly。

    5.在线编程环境:在线编程环境是一种基于云计算的编程工具,可以通过网络访问并在浏览器中使用。它们通常具有代码编辑器、调试器和协作功能,方便多人合作和远程开发。一些常见的在线编程环境包括GitHub Codespaces和Replit。

    总之,选择适合自己的编程软件取决于个人的偏好、编程语言和项目需求。无论是使用文本编辑器还是IDE,关键是熟悉工具的功能和使用方法,以提高编程效率和质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种创造性的活动,需要使用特定的软件工具来编写、测试和运行代码。对于不同的编程语言和应用场景,有多种不同的编程软件可供选择。下面是一些常用的编程软件:

    1. 文本编辑器:文本编辑器是最基本的编程工具,用于编写代码。它们通常提供基本的语法高亮、自动补全、代码折叠等功能。常见的文本编辑器有Sublime Text、Notepad++、Atom等。

    2. 集成开发环境(IDE):IDE是一种集成了多种开发工具的软件,用于提供更完整的编程环境。IDE通常包含了代码编辑器、调试器、编译器、版本控制工具等功能。不同的编程语言有不同的IDE,例如Java的Eclipse和IntelliJ IDEA,Python的PyCharm,C#的Visual Studio等。

    3. Jupyter Notebook:Jupyter Notebook是一种交互式编程环境,主要用于数据科学和机器学习。它可以在浏览器中编写和运行代码,并支持以文档形式保存代码、图表、文本和其他富文本内容。

    4. 命令行工具:一些编程语言提供了命令行工具,可以直接在命令行中编写和运行代码。例如,Python提供了交互式解释器和脚本模式,可以在命令行中输入Python代码并即时执行。

    5. 数据库管理工具:对于与数据库交互的编程任务,可以使用数据库管理工具来编写和管理数据库代码。常见的数据库管理工具有MySQL Workbench、Navicat、pgAdmin等。

    6. 版本控制工具:版本控制工具用于管理和跟踪代码的变更。它们可以帮助开发人员协作、备份代码、回滚代码等。常见的版本控制工具有Git和SVN。

    总结来说,选择编程软件取决于你使用的编程语言和开发环境,以及个人的偏好和需求。无论选择哪种软件,重要的是熟悉和掌握它们的功能,以提高编程效率和代码质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部